Blue Arrow HS is recruiting for a skilled Class 1 Tramper Driver (HIAB) for an industry-leading building materials contract. This role involves delivering products across the UK, and candidates must have a minimum of 6 months experience and a valid HIAB licence.
Attractive pay at £18.07 per hour plus a tax-free night-out allowance of £26.20, along with the option to choose between depots in Dorket Head or Leicester Road. This is a long-term opportunity with commitment to Health & Safety emphasized.
